In “The Julia Set,” she portrays a numbers genius in the most convincing way possible — by wearing her virtuosity lightly and casually, as if it were second nature (which, for someone like Julia, it is). But she also makes Julia a highly focused and mature young woman who is still, by virtue of age and inexperience, just naïve enough to be poised between assertion and following the lead of a dude she should have steered clear of.
